    Abstract: An identity chaining fraud detection method that allows each current transaction to be linked to other transactions through commonly shared identities. Over a period of time the links create a chain of associated transactions which can be analyzed to determine if identity variances occur, which indicates that fraud is detected. Additionally, if a specific identity is detected as being fraudulent, that identity can be tagged as fraudulent and can be referenced by a plurality of other merchant transaction chains to determine fraud.

    Abstract: According to the present disclosure, the use of a nanoliposome in the manufacture of a medicament for the prophylaxis and/or treatment of anterior segment ocular diseases is provided. The nanoliposome comprises a plurality of unsaturated and/or saturated lipids forming at least one lipid bilayer encapsulating a hydrophobic drug comprising tacrolimus, wherein the hydrophobic drug and the plurality of unsaturated and/or saturated lipids have a weight ratio of up to 0.2. The present disclosure also provides for such a nanoliposome and a method of preventing and/or treating anterior segment ocular diseases based on the nanoliposomes.

    Abstract: This invention concerns imageable, radiopaque embolic beads, which are particularly useful for monitoring embolization procedures. The beads comprise iodine containing compounds which are covalently incorporated into the polymer network of a preformed hydrogel bead. The beads are prepared by activating pre-formed hydrogel beads towards nucleophilic attack and then covalently attaching iodinated compounds into the polymer network. The radiopaque beads may be loaded with chemotherapeutic agents and used in methods of embolizing hyperplastic tissue or solid tumors.
